Abstract

One of the reported doping agent to increase TiO2 activity is Cu. In this research, TiO2 was prepared by So-Gel method. Preparation was performed by calcinaton at the temperature range of 400, 500, 600°C for 2 hours with a corresponding dopan concentration of 0%, 1%, 3%, 5% mol of TiO2. The nanoparticle materials was characterized using XRD. It is found that anatase phase occur in the calcinations temperature of 400°C and transform to rutile phase at 500°C. The crystallite size of Cu-doped TiO2 with dopan concentration of 5% are found 4.63 nm, 8.70 nm, 6.09 nm respectively at 400°C, 500°C, 600°C.
